Tip of the Week:
There are lots of tricks to counting carbs, and the more you do it, the easier it is.
Here’s a carb counting tip from a grandmother who has learned a lot about carb counting in the last seven years. Find more like this in the HealthSims Type 1 Diabetes training course.
My grandson likes his grilled cheese and other sandwiches with the crusts cut off. Remember that doing that inpacts the carb count of the bread. We figured out that cutting the crusts off our bread reduced the carbs from 16 a slice to 10 a slice by weighing the bread slice before and after. - Dee, grandmother of a child with diabetes
